BUSCHETTU

Absolutely rare, it would seem specific to the province of Oristano, it could derive from a place name. additions provided by Anna Maria Buschettu The origin of the Sardinian surname Buschettu, could be from the Catalan surname Busquets typical of Barcelona and Mallorca. In 1410 a Raymond Busquets was responsible for the royal incomes, while his son Tommaso was councilor of the Castle. additions provided by Giuseppe Concas BUSCHETTU: buscu, buschettu = forest, small wood - Italianism. We did not find it in the ancient maps in our possession, but in the administrative history of Cagliari there are two Busquets (of Catalan origin): Raimondo Busquets, 1410 and Giovanni Busquets, chief councilor, 1535 - 1541 - 1545. Currently the surname is present in 7 Italian Municipalities, of which 5 in Sardinia: Palmas Arborea 21, Sassari 9, Cabras 6, etc.
